Outdoor Spiritual Practices: Simple Ways to Deepen Your Journey

For the Soulful Explorer, nature isn’t just a backdrop. It’s alive, responsive, and full of wisdom. Every rustling leaf, flowing stream, and patch of earth has the power to speak to your spirit if you take the time to listen. When life feels heavy or uncertain, stepping outside can open a doorway to peace and connection.

Here are some gentle rituals to help you deepen your spiritual path in nature:

Sit spot

Choose one outdoor place. It could be a bench in the park, a tree in your garden, or a quiet corner in the woods. By returning to it regularly, you get to know it and you feel comfortable there. Over time, you’ll notice subtle changes: the shifting light, new birdsong, the scent of the air. It becomes a mirror of your own inner changes.

Seasonal noticing

Each week, write down one shift you observe in the natural world. Perhaps you have seen the first frost, the emergence of buds, or the softening of light in autumn. By doing this simple practice, you connect to the cycles of life. Intuitively, you feel your connection to all that is around you.

Barefoot grounding

Place your bare feet on grass, soil, or sand. Feel the solid earth beneath you. Imagine the ground drawing away tension and offering steadiness in return.

Listening walk

Wander slowly without a destination. Focus only on the sounds around you – birds, wind through branches, even the silence between. Listening deeply brings you into harmony with your surroundings.

These quiet practices don’t require hours of time or special equipment. They’re invitations to be fully present, to see and feel how the Earth is always supporting you.
